Weakened pipeline joints
Pipeline joints are the parts of our plumbing system where the pipelines attach. They are the weakest point of our plumbing system. Therefore, they are extra prone to degeneration. It is necessary to note that even though pipelines are designed to stand up to pressure and also last for some time, they weren't created to last forever; consequently, they would certainly weaken with time. This damage could cause splits in plumbing systems. An usual indication of damaged pipeline joints is too much noise from faucets.
High water pressure
You noticed your residence water stress is greater than typical however then, why should you care? It's out of your control.
It would certainly be best if you cared because your typical water stress should be 60 Psi (per square inch) and also although your home's plumbing system is developed to hold up against 80 Psi. An increase in water pressure can place a stress on your residence pipelines and also bring about splits, or worse, ruptured pipelines. If you ever notice that your residence water pressure is greater than normal, contact a specialist about regulating it.

Obstructed drains
Food particles, dust, and also oil can cause blocked drains and block the flow of water in and out of your sink. If undealt with, boosted pressure within the gutters can trigger an overflow and finish up cracking or breaking pipelines. To prevent blocked drains pipes in your house, we suggest you to prevent pouring particles away as well as normal cleaning of sinks.

5 TIPS IN DETECTING A WATER LEAK IN YOUR HOUSE
Water leaks can be hard to find in your home, yet they can be so common. We rely on water every day in our home, which is why a leak can cause big problems. By detecting them early, you can save money and further damage, getting the problem fixed as soon as possible. Here are 5 tips to help you detect a water leak in your home, so you can contact a plumber straight away and get the issue sorted.
Check your water meter
Many people underestimate the value of the water meter in their home. It can be one of the best ways to tell if you have a leak early on, so you can get on top of it before issues start arising. Start by turning off all the water in your home: taps, washing machine, dishwasher, etc. Now take a look at the meter – if it’s still changing with everything turned off, it’s likely you have a fast-flowing leak that you need to get on top of straight away. If nothing changes, then leave your meter for an hour or two and come back to it. Did it change in this time? It’s likely you have a slower leak, which isn’t as urgent but still handy to get fixed so it doesn’t become a bigger problem.
Keep an eye on your bill
Another good way to detect a leak in your home is by keeping an eye on your water bill. It helps if you have a past bill from the same period of time. You can compare like for like and determine whether your water usage has increased significantly. If it has, there may be a leak in your system that you haven’t picked up before. A professional plumber can check through all of your pipes and determine where it is coming from.
Look for damage
If you have a leak inside your home, you will notice damage over time. Take a look at your showers and bathtubs and note whether any of the tiles surrounding the area seem to be discoloured or damaged in any way. There may be water stains, mould or peeling material that has resulted from a build up of moisture over time. Make sure you take a look under sinks at the back of cupboards that don’t get accessed regularly. This is where damage can go unnoticed and build up over periods of time.
